Another way to make queries faster is, if you can, identify a subset of
documents that are in general relevant for the users (most recent ones,
most browsed etc etc), index those documents into a separate collection and
then query the small collection and back out to the full one if the small
one didn't have enough documents (caveat: the small collection could affect
the ranking because all terms stats will be different..)

In addition to Toke's suggestions (and those in the linked article), some
more ideas:
If single-term, bare queries are slow, it might be productive to check
config/performance of your queryResultCache (I realize this doesn't
directly address the concern of slow queries, but might nonetheless be
helpful in practice).
If multi-term queries that include these terms are slow, maybe check your
mm config to make sure it's not more inclusive than necessary for your use
case (scoring over union of docSets/clauses). If multi-term queries get
faster by disabling pf, you could try disabling main-query pf, and invoke
implicit phrase search (pseudo-pf) using ReRankQParser?
If you're able to share your configs (built queries, indexing/fieldType
config (positions, payloads?), etc.), that might enable more specific
advice.
I'm assuming the query-times posted are for queries that isolate the
performance of main query only (i.e., no other components, like facets,
etc.)?

On Mon, 2019-04-08 at 09:58 +1000, Ash Ramesh wrote:
> We have a corpus of 50+ million documents in our collection. I've
> noticed that some queries with specific keywords tend to be extremely
> slow.
> E.g. the q=`photography' or q='background'. After digging into the
> raw documents, I could see that these two terms appear in greater
> than 90% of all documents, which means solr has to score each of
> those documents.

That is known behaviour, which can be remedied somewhat. Stop words is
a common approach, but your samples does not seem to fit well with
that. Instead you can look at Common Grams, where your high-frequency
words gets concatenated with surrounding words. This only works with
phrases though. There's a nice article at

https://www.hathitrust.org/blogs/large-scale-search/slow-queries-and-common-words-part-2

Hi everybody,

We have a corpus of 50+ million documents in our collection. I've noticed
that some queries with specific keywords tend to be extremely slow. E.g.
the q=`photography' or q='background'. After digging into the raw
documents, I could see that these two terms appear in greater than 90% of
all documents, which means solr has to score each of those documents.

Is there a best practise to deal with these sort of queries? Should solr be
able to handle these queries normally quickly (we have 8 shards). The
average, reproducible time for the response on these queries is between
1.5-2.5 seconds.

Please let me know if more information is required.
